GCL ET Explores Opening AI Data Centre in Indonesia
Southeast Asia is a key region in GCL ET’s international AI data centre strategy, particularly Malaysia, Indonesia, and Thailand. Fanzhong Zeng, Head of Strategic Development Center at GCL Energy Technology, stated in Beijing on Monday (29/6) that Indonesia is one of the markets receiving the company’s attention, alongside Malaysia and Thailand, due to its proximity to Singapore, digital economic growth, and supportive energy resource potential. He noted that Singapore’s position as a digital infrastructure and data centre hub in Asia is driving new project development in neighbouring countries, including Indonesia, given Singapore’s land and electricity capacity constraints. The Suzhou-based company is actively exploring AI data centre business opportunities in Malaysia and Indonesia with local partners to support industry development. Zeng explained that the opportunity to open AI data centres is not only related to computing needs but also to the availability of stable, green, and efficient energy. ‘Each market has a different energy structure, customer needs, and industrial ecosystem. Therefore, we will not simply copy one identical model, but work with local partners to find a cooperation model that suits local market conditions,’ he said. GCL ET is developing integrated solutions for AI data centre projects through an approach that combines wind, solar, energy storage, gas-fired power generation, and computing infrastructure in a single system. This approach aims to address the challenges of AI data centre development, especially in regions where grid capacity is not yet always able to quickly support large-scale data centre needs. He said that the global growth of AI is continuously increasing the need for computing power, leading the company to see an increasingly close relationship between energy and computing. ‘The current AI wave aligns with our strategy to integrate energy and computing power,’ Zeng added. There are two main directions in this integration strategy: first, ‘powering computing’, where GCL ET utilises its capabilities in energy generation, energy management, and electricity trading to provide cheaper, reliable, and environmentally friendly energy solutions for AI data centres. The second direction is ‘empowering energy with AI’, using AI to improve efficiency in the energy sector, including the management of renewable energy plants, electric vehicle charging stations, electricity trading systems, and load management. ‘By combining these two approaches, we are building a closed-loop ecosystem between energy and computing power,’ he said. Since 2023, GCL ET has begun investing in computing services with a value of approximately 800 million RMB (around Rp2.1 trillion), including AI computing infrastructure based on NVIDIA A800 and H800 systems. Previously known as an energy investment and services company, GCL ET is now expanding its business scope to become a technology-based service provider integrating energy, computing, and electricity trading.
